GermanPpartial success of the investigation by the Federal Criminal Police Office (BKA) and the Central Office for Combating Cybercrime (ZIT). Their investigators have succeeded in shutting down the illegal marketplace “Kingdom Market” on the Darknet.

This marketplace featured an extensive range of illegal products, encompassing drugs, malware, counterfeit documents, and criminal services. German law enforcement disclosed that the platform hosted over 42,000 products, with around 3,600 originating from Germany. The Kingdom Market shutdown highlights the effectiveness of international coordination in combating organized cybercrime. The seized server infrastructure is currently under evaluation as authorities work to identify and apprehend those responsible for operating the illegal marketplace. The Kingdom Market was established in March 2021, the offer of the dark web marketplace included drugs, malware, stolen data, and forged documents. Kingdom Market boasted tens of thousands of customer accounts and several hundred registered sellers, featuring a listing that comprised 42,000 items.

When a dispute is opened on Kingdom onion, the automatic completion will be canceled. In the Kingdom chat to discuss disputes, the buyer describes his problem related to the order, and the Kingdom Shop seller can answer it. Any evidence, such as files or screenshots, can be provided if necessary to facilitate the resolution of the dispute. If one of the parties does not respond to the dispute within 96 hours of the opening of the dispute, the decision will be made by Kingdom market without their presence and, most likely, in favor of the other party. According to the US court documents, a cluster of cryptocurrency addresses that the Kingdom employed allowed for the tracking of specific cryptocurrency transactions to wallets registered in BILL’s name. Notably, on December 15, US law enforcement officials arrested Alan Bill, alias “Vend0r” or “KingdomOfficial,” who was suspected of being the Kingdom Market’s administrator.
